Integer overflow in SAP Se Netweaver Application Server For Abap And Platform
CVE-2026-66767
SAP NetWeaver Application Server for ABAP and ABAP Platform allows an unauthenticated user to send a specially crafted packet that triggers reprocessing of a previously buffered user request, potentially hijacking another user's session under narrow timing conditions. Successful exploitation could result in high impact on confidentiality and integrity, with low impact on availability of the application.
CVSS v3 metric
CVSS v3 base score 7.7 (High). Vector: CVSS:3.1/AV:N/AC:H/PR:N/UI:N/S:U/C:H/I:H/A:L.
Affected products
- Sap_se Sap Netweaver Application Server For Abap And Platform — versions 7.22EXT, 7.53, 7.54
